About This Course

DevOps is a modern software development approach that combines development and IT operations to automate, streamline, and accelerate the software delivery lifecycle. It emphasizes collaboration, continuous integration, continuous deployment (CI/CD), infrastructure automation, and continuous monitoring to deliver reliable applications faster. DevOps professionals use industry-standard tools such as Linux, Git, Docker, Kubernetes, and Jenkins to manage source code, containerize applications, automate deployments, and monitor system performance. Learning DevOps equips learners with practical skills in automation, cloud-native deployment, container orchestration, and infrastructure management. These capabilities are highly valued across industries and prepare learners for rewarding careers as DevOps Engineers, Cloud Engineers, Site Reliability Engineers, and Infrastructure Engineers in today's technology-driven organizations.
